Output d81f6d3c943c791a250329a254106fe45691d0f8d6c05a1bf846e718f06b7c9f:0

value
422822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e109fa640d6805806fa3eee1354c144da8ce8f OP_EQUAL
address
3EG45okB6JrYohsK9gecDQA7CenCfRArXH
transaction
d81f6d3c943c791a250329a254106fe45691d0f8d6c05a1bf846e718f06b7c9f
spent
true